"Sons of Providence: The Brown Brothers, the Slave Trade, and the American Revolution"
Meet the Browns
Story aired: Friday, May 19, 2006



Charles Rappleye speaks about his new book "Sons of Providence," which looks at one of Rhode Island's founding families, the Browns. In the 18th century, the Browns were shipping rum to Africa, where they'd pick up slaves to bring to the Caribbean, where they'd pick up the ingredients to make the rum.
